Is oxygen reactive with sodium

User Avatar

Anonymous

13y ago
Updated: 8/19/2019

Oxygen react with sodium: the two oxides are Na2O and Na2O2.

How does sodium react with oxygen?

Sodium reacts vigorously with oxygen to form sodium oxide, Na2O. This reaction is exothermic and can result in the release of heat and light. Sodium is a highly reactive metal and readily combines with oxygen to form an oxide.

Which element is more likely to react with oxygen Sodium or Calcium please explain if you can thank you?

Sodium. Sodium is more reactive than calcium, because sodium has one valence electron whereas calcium has two valence electron. It is easier to lose one electron and react with oxygen and form sodium oxide, compared to losing two electrons and from calcium oxide.

What are chemical properties for sodium?

Sodium is a highly reactive metal. It reacts with water to give sodium hydroxide, and with carbon dioxide to give sodium carbonate. It the reaction with oxygen, the principal product is sodium peroxide.
